Welcome to the Reportly crew at Vexora Labs! Quick heads-up: all report exports are stored in UTC, but customers see their local timezone in the UI. The converter runs at export time, so if a CSV looks "off by a few hours," it's almost always a timezone config mismatch, not corrupt data. To poke at the raw export rows yourself, connect to the staging reports database using the following:

replica DSN, kajep-yahag: mssql://praok_svc:iF@db-8d68.plorvaio.local:5432/eliion

Subject: Key rotation — CastGauge validator

Rotation for the CastGauge podcast feed validator completes tonight at 22:00. The old key stops working immediately after.

Impact: the release pipeline's feed-lint step will fail if the secret isn't swapped before the 1.9.3 cut. Nothing else depends on this credential.

Action for you: update the pipeline secret store entry, rerun the smoke check, confirm in the release channel. Staging already rotated cleanly this morning.

New key for the validator service follows below.

API key for yahig-tadup: kto7_ubizbYm

Handover note — Tumblegate laundry-locker access flow

Hi, welcome aboard. The Tumblegate locker flow issues one-time door codes after payment confirms; the fallback path triggers when the payment callback times out. Watch the retry queue daily — stuck entries mean residents can't open lockers. Admin overrides live in the Hatchkey console. To authenticate there during your first week, use the temporary recovery passphrase noted below.

unlock words, hahip-baduf: holwyn-istath-julvan